  • Fantastic 4: Rise of the Silver Surfer
       Sequel to make appearance on every game console
    May 15th, 2007 - As soon as you heard there was going to be a new Fantastic Four movie, you were guaranteed there’d be a new game to go along with it, to feature the fearless foursome.

    The game will feature co-op style brawling, with a focus on combo moves and teamwork, which of course makes sense given the source material. Players will have to control each member of the team in each level, with character-specific obstacles and enemies. Mr. Fantastic can stretch to attack and use his scientific skills, he Invisible Woman will utilize her invisibility and force powers, The Thing uses his massive size and strength, and the Human Torch will use his flaming attacks to inflict damage.

    The game features elements from the new movie, but also takes some stories and locales from the comic books to add depth, including a battle in an alien Skrull mine.

    The Wii version of the game will make the most of the motion sensitive controller, and both the Wii and PS2 versions will include 4 player co-op play.

    Game: Fantastic 4: Rise of the Silver Surfer
    Publisher: Take-Two Interactive
    Developer: Visual Concepts
    Release Date: June 15th, 2007
